Handover — Pavilion Kiosk Watchdog

To whoever takes on-call next: the kiosk app at the Fernway terminals is supervised by a watchdog process that restarts the UI if the heartbeat file goes stale. Restarts are logged and rate-limited, so repeated triggers mean a real fault, not flapping. Before paging anyone, check the watchdog's current settings, which are as follows.

deployment values, yafop-tahof:
HOLIX_HOST=holix.zemvarsys.internal
HOLIX_PORT=3306

Ticket: Inkpress markdown pipeline rejecting rendered bundles with signature verification failure since the 5.2 deploy. Root cause: the verifier still references the retired key from the Quillmark era. Maintainers should update the trust store and re-run the render queue. Configure the verifier to accept the key below.

rollout seal: bky4_yke3

This page documents the planned wind-down of the Fennhall satellite office operated by Quillard Systems. Finance should note that lease obligations run through March, and early-termination costs have been modelled by Tobias Renner's team. Staff reassignments to the Ashgrove site are being handled individually, with relocation stipends under review. Equipment disposal follows standard asset procedure. Please keep all figures within this group. The strategic rationale is recorded immediately below.

internal memo for taguf-kafop: Novmirax Group plans to lower the Oliius list price by 42.0 percent in March. The board signed off on a budget of $367.8 million for Project Belael. The renewal with Drumirax Logistics closes at $302.4 million a year, 54.0 percent below the last contract. Project Kelys slips by a full year because of the staffing delay.

// Log sampling configuration for the Pinemarten telemetry client.
// The Burrowdeep inventory service emits roughly 9k log lines per
// minute at steady state, so we sample INFO at 1% and WARN at 25%.
// ERROR is never sampled. If on-call needs full fidelity during an
// incident, set PINEMARTEN_SAMPLE_OVERRIDE=1 and restart the pod.
// The client below authenticates to the internal sampling control
// plane using the key on the next line.

gateway credential: kto11_pTkcHgLwuNE